服务器里网页被篡改是一个严重的安全问题,它不仅影响网站的正常运营,还可能对用户造成误导或损失,本文将详细探讨网页被篡改的原因、检测方法、应对措施以及预防策略,并提供两个常见问题的解答。
一、网页被篡改的原因
1、黑客攻击:黑客利用网站漏洞(如SQL注入、XSS跨站脚本攻击等)获取服务器权限,进而修改网页内容。
2、弱密码:管理员使用简单或默认密码,容易被破解,导致服务器被非法访问。
3、软件漏洞:服务器操作系统、Web服务器软件或应用程序存在未修复的安全漏洞。
4、第三方组件风险:使用的第三方插件、模块或服务存在安全缺陷,被恶意利用。
5、内部人员操作失误或恶意行为:内部员工误操作或故意篡改网页内容。
6、病毒感染:服务器被病毒感染,病毒程序自动修改网页文件。
二、网页被篡改的检测方法
1、定期检查:定期手动检查网页文件,对比备份文件,查看是否有异常更改。
2、文件监控:使用文件监控工具(如Tripwire、AIDE等)实时监控网页文件的变化。
3、日志分析:分析服务器日志,查找异常访问记录或错误信息。
4、安全扫描:使用安全扫描工具(如Nessus、OpenVAS等)定期扫描服务器,发现潜在漏洞。
5、入侵检测系统(IDS):部署IDS,实时监测网络流量和系统活动,及时发现入侵行为。
6、内容完整性校验:使用哈希值(如MD5、SHA-256)校验网页文件的完整性。
三、网页被篡改后的应对措施
1、立即隔离:将受影响的服务器从网络中隔离,防止进一步损害。
2、恢复备份:从最新的备份中恢复被篡改的网页文件。
3、更改密码:更改所有相关账户的密码,包括管理员账户、数据库账户等。
4、修补漏洞:及时修补服务器、Web服务器软件、应用程序及第三方组件的安全漏洞。
5、清理恶意代码:彻底清除服务器上的恶意代码和病毒。
6、通知用户和搜索引擎:如果网页被篡改影响了用户数据或搜索引擎排名,应及时通知用户并申请搜索引擎重新索引。
7、法律行动:如果发现有恶意攻击者,应收集证据并考虑采取法律行动。
四、预防网页被篡改的策略
1、强化密码策略:使用复杂且独特的密码,并定期更换。
2、定期更新和打补丁:保持服务器操作系统、Web服务器软件、应用程序及第三方组件的最新状态。
3、限制访问权限:最小化用户权限,仅授予必要的访问权限。
4、使用防火墙和安全组:配置防火墙规则和安全组,限制不必要的网络访问。
5、部署Web应用防火墙(WAF):WAF可以过滤恶意请求,保护Web应用免受攻击。
6、实施安全编码实践:在开发过程中遵循安全编码标准,减少漏洞的产生。
7、定期备份:定期备份网页文件和数据库,以便在发生篡改时迅速恢复。
8、安全教育和培训:提高员工的安全意识,定期进行安全培训。
五、FAQs
Q1: 如何判断网页是否被篡改?
A1: 判断网页是否被篡改可以通过以下几种方法:
视觉检查:直接浏览网页,看是否有异常内容或布局变化。
文件对比:将当前网页文件与之前的备份或已知良好的版本进行对比,查看是否有差异。
哈希值校验:计算网页文件的哈希值(如MD5、SHA-256),与之前保存的哈希值进行比较,如果不一致,则说明文件被篡改。
日志分析:检查服务器日志,看是否有异常的访问记录或错误信息,这可能表明网页被篡改。
安全扫描:使用安全扫描工具对服务器进行扫描,查找潜在的安全威胁和篡改迹象。
Q2: 如果网页被篡改了,我应该怎么办?
A2: 如果发现网页被篡改,应立即采取以下措施:
隔离服务器:将受影响的服务器从网络中隔离,防止进一步的损害和数据泄露。
恢复备份:从最新的备份中恢复被篡改的网页文件,确保网站内容的完整性和准确性。
更改密码:更改所有相关账户的密码,包括管理员账户、FTP账户、数据库账户等,以防止攻击者再次访问。
修补漏洞:审查服务器、Web服务器软件、应用程序及第三方组件的安全性,及时修补存在的漏洞。
清理恶意代码:使用反病毒软件和恶意代码清理工具,彻底清除服务器上的恶意代码和病毒。
通知用户和搜索引擎:如果网页被篡改影响了用户数据或搜索引擎排名,应及时通知用户并申请搜索引擎重新索引。
加强安全防护:实施更严格的安全措施,如强化密码策略、限制访问权限、部署Web应用防火墙(WAF)等,以防止未来再次发生类似事件。
各位小伙伴们,我刚刚为大家分享了有关“服务器里网页被篡改”的知识,希望对你们有所帮助。如果您还有其他相关问题需要解决,欢迎随时提出哦!
【版权声明】:本站所有内容均来自网络,若无意侵犯到您的权利,请及时与我们联系将尽快删除相关内容!
发表回复